Output def6f2cafc9d482ab2d4270e6572081eefec82fa4eaf3e3754c5b370f1d9d37e:1

value
29792155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d59036fb20168cf4d598b68e8ceda5e5ee6c2f5 OP_EQUAL
address
3MsPthWq2SE6zw71gKRYjxYuGj4djoUyBm
transaction
def6f2cafc9d482ab2d4270e6572081eefec82fa4eaf3e3754c5b370f1d9d37e
spent
true